How Common Is The Last Name Claff?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 1,604,449th most commonly held last name at a global level. It is borne by around 1 in 57,837,666 people. The surname Claff occurs mostly in Oceania, where 45 percent of Claff live; 45 percent live in Australasia and 45 percent live in Australia and New Zealand.

This last name is most frequently held in Australia, where it is borne by 57 people, or 1 in 473,609. In Australia Claff is primarily concentrated in: New South Wales, where 89 percent are found and Victoria, where 11 percent are found. Beside Australia this last name exists in 6 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 31 percent are found and England, where 14 percent are found.

Claff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Claff has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Claff surname expanded 244 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it expanded 450 percent between 1881 and 2014.
